Fort Lauderdale Fishing with Top Shot Sportfishing Charter Boat and Capt. Zsak
Thresher Shark tony s.jpg

Al Bifolco and his son, Anthony, were down from the northeast to get in some fishing and decided to charter the Top Shot Sportfishing charter boat team to do some deep sea charter boat sport fishing in Fort Lauderdale, FL. We had a nice day with easterly winds and calm seas ranging from 1 to 2 feet.

Fifteen to twenty minutes after leaving the dock, lines were in the water at 120 ft., 1.8 miles from shore. Shortly after getting the three baits set, I adjusted the boat keeping the bow in the current and wind. It important to hold the depth of water to effectively fish these baits. It allows for the scent and oil to keep behind the boat creating a scent trail.

All of a sudden, the middle bait started to move out of position which is a good sign. The clicker started to click and the drag started to rip out. We had a big shark on! Al was our angler and he fought this fish gaining and losing line. Next, his son, Anthony, was up fighting the Shark, also gaining and losing line. Al and Anthony both took turns fighting this Shark for a few hours and both guys did a great job. After changing angles on the Shark and applying different angling techniques, the monster finally surfaced, a 12' Thresher Shark. We got some photos, cut the hooks out and released this sea monster back into the waters. Great job Al and Anthony fighting this killer Thresher Shark.
